Xiaomi Increased Prices Of 2 Mobile Phones & LED TV, Buy Today If You Need

Xiaomi increased Prices Of Some Mobile Phones & LED TV, Buy Today If You Need as New Price will be Effective from 11 November 2018. As you are aware, rupee has depreciated against the dollar by nearly 15% since the be-ginning of the year, which has resulted in a significant rise in input cost for Xiaomi.

Their Statement on Twitter:-

Dear Mi Fans,
Xiaomi has always worked on bringing you innovative technology with incredible specs of the highest quality and we also strive to ensure that these are available to you at the most honest prices.

As you are aware, rupee has depreciated against the dollar by nearly 15% since the be-ginning of the year, which has resulted in a significant rise in input cost for us. To offset this, a few of our products will witness marginal price adjustment and will now move on from their introductory price phase announced during their launch in September

• Redmi 6A (2GB+16GB) and (2GB+32GB) variants will have a slight price increase of INR 600 and INR 500 respectively, and would now be available for INR 6,599 and INR 7,499 respectively.

• Redmi 6 (3GB+32GB) will have a slight price increase of INR 500 and would be available for INR 8,499.

• Mi LED TV 4C Pro 32 and Mi LED TV 4A Pro 49 will witness a price increase of INR 1,000 and INR 2,000 respectively, and would be available for INR 15,999 and INR 31,999 respectively.

• 10000mAh Mi Power Bank 2i Black will also see a slight price increase of INR 100, and would be available for INR 899.
The new prices are effective at midnight from today, 11 November 2018 onwards.

At Xiaomi, we strive to make the highest quality products available to all at honest pricing for all. In fact, Xiaomi is not a company that runs after profit margins. Xiaomi has pledged that our overall hardware net profit margin will never exceed 5% and we have ensured that with the price adjustments, we provide extremely competitive pricing in the industry.
